Step 2 of the cron drift investigation for Tallyhart's scheduler fleet. Compare each worker's clock offset against the Quorrel time service before touching job definitions; drift above 400ms explains the duplicate nightly exports we saw. If offsets look sane, the problem is almost certainly the stale scheduler config that survived last month's redeploy. To verify, diff the running daemon's settings against the canonical set, reproduced in full directly below.

settings of fafog-haduf:
ZORIX_PIN=4648
ZORIX_METRICS_HOST=metrics.zorix.paliqsys.corp
ZORIX_LOG_LEVEL=info
ZORIX_TENANT=druix

Quarterly Planning Note — Reseller Programme

Branch managers: the Copperline reseller push continues next quarter. We're adding two partner tiers and a demo-kit allowance, so expect more walk-ins asking about the Harlow bundle. Keep onboarding under two weeks and flag slow movers to regional early. Targets land with your monthly pack. The confidential business-plan note is appended right below.

board note of kageg-bahof: The renewal with Holwynax Holdings closes at $2 million a year, 5 percent below the last contract. Project Ulaath slips by two quarters because of the supplier delay.

## Deployment

The Quillhook handlers run on the Vantra serverless platform, which spins containers down after roughly ten minutes of inactivity. Cold starts add two to four seconds, mostly from dependency loading and the warm-up query against the catalog cache. We mitigate this with a keep-alive pinger and provisioned concurrency on the checkout path; other routes just eat the latency. If you're deploying for the first time, use the standard settings below. The production deployment configuration is as follows.

service settings:
druael:
  log_level: error
  metrics_host: metrics.druael.tolvaqlabs.internal
  pool_size: 16